Basement Waterproofing in Clinton, IA

Before: The basement walls of this Peru, IL, home were in a state of severe distress, bowing inward under the relentless hydrostatic pressure of the surrounding soil. Large horizontal cracks and frowning masonry indicated that the structure was nearing a critical failure point, leaving the homeowner in a constant state of anxiety over a potential cave-in. These unsightly worry lines were a clear warning sign that the home’s foundation was losing its battle against the elements and required immediate intervention to prevent a total collapse.

 

After: Our team at MidAmerica Basement Systems transformed the failing space into a model of structural integrity using the GeoLock Wall Anchor and PowerBrace systems. By anchoring into stable soil and reinforcing the interior with high-strength steel beams, we successfully neutralized the external pressure. The formerly leaning walls are now standing tall and true, replacing years of wall woes with a solid, secure foundation and providing the homeowner with long-awaited peace of mind.
